Half Day Walking Tour Lagoa do Fogo

Submitted by admin on Tue, 03/07/2023 - 10:10
This walking tour starts in the south coast of the island, near Fogo mountain and ends in the same place, being a circular trail.This is a beautiful walking trail, full of endemic plants and wild vegetation. You will also have the chance to see a bird valley, an impressive water channel known as "Levada" and a striking view of Lagoa do Fogo.

Pedestrian Walk Serra Devassa (Half day)

Submitted by admin on Tue, 03/07/2023 - 10:09
This short circular trail begins and ends opposite the Lagoa do Canário and takes about 2 hours to be completed. Along the way it enables the view of several lakes, (Lagoa Pau Pique Lake, Lagoa das Éguas and Lagoa Rasa) and crosses an area ranging between 750 and 900 metres in altitude, that’s the reason why it should be chosen when visibility is good.Extension5 kmNOTE: a minimum of 2 persons is required.
